'Never been as wrong' - Man United fans react to Darwin Nunez transfer fee claims

With Edinson Cavani departing on a free transfer this summer and Antony Martial expected to leave, Cristiano Ronaldo will be the only striker left at Old Trafford next season. This means that Manchester United must sign a striker as at 38, the Portuguese icon can not perform at the top level while playing two games a week; as fans saw this season.

Chris Silverwood - Brendon Maccullum - Tim Southee - England 'won't die wondering' under McCullum, says Southee - timesofindia.indiatimes.com - New Zealand

England 'won't die wondering' under McCullum, says Southee

Tim Southee has forecast an exciting time for England under Brendon McCullum as the former New Zealand captain prepares to go up against the reigning World Test champions at Lord's. Thursday's opening match of a three-game series will be McCullum's first Test as England coach, with the hosts looking to him to kickstart their red-ball fortunes in much the same way he sparked a New Zealand revival when captain of his native country. England are currently on a miserable run of one win in 17 Tests, with McCullum something of a surprise choice to succeed Chris Silverwood given his lack of red-ball coaching experience, although he will be working alongside a captain with a similar outlook in the newly-appointed Ben Stokes.
